The Salesforce data model is a tapestry of standard and custom objects, relational mappings, and metadata configurations. Custom objects allow enterprises to represent unique business entities not accommodated by out-of-the-box constructs. Effective data architecture requires thoughtful design, minimizing redundancy while maximizing accessibility.
Analysts play a critical role in structuring these models. Decisions regarding master-detail relationships, lookup relationships, and junction objects dictate how information propagates across modules and interfaces. Optimizing these relationships ensures that reporting, automation, and integrations function seamlessly, while also providing scalability for future business evolution. Poorly architected data models can lead to performance bottlenecks, reporting inconsistencies, and operational friction, making this an area of paramount concern.

In Salesforce, data relationships form an intricate lattice that underpins every analytical endeavor. Mastery of relational data architecture requires more than familiarity with objects and fields; it necessitates an appreciation for the subtle interplay between entities and their interdependencies. The business analyst must cultivate an almost cartographic understanding of these connections, tracing each relationship to ensure the logical coherence of the system.
Lookup and master-detail relationships serve distinct purposes, each imparting a unique structural rhythm to data flow. Lookup relationships provide flexible, loosely coupled linkages, whereas master-detail relationships enforce dependency and cascade behaviors, dictating the fate of child records in response to parent actions. Understanding the implications of these relational paradigms enables analysts to craft a resilient, scalable data ecosystem, minimizing redundancy while maximizing analytical utility.

Salesforce’s ecosystem is segmented into multifaceted modules, each embodying specialized functionality yet interwoven with others to create a holistic operational matrix. Sales Cloud orchestrates revenue generation by centralizing leads, opportunities, and forecasts, providing analytical insight into pipeline velocity and conversion efficacy. Service Cloud fortifies customer experience, harnessing case management, knowledge repositories, and AI-driven support to anticipate and resolve client exigencies. Marketing Cloud engages audiences with precision-targeted campaigns, behavioral segmentation, and automated nurture sequences, ensuring that messaging resonates on individual levels. Commerce Cloud amalgamates digital commerce channels, delivering continuity across web, mobile, and in-store touchpoints.
The interlacing of these modules is not incidental but strategic. Data transmuted in one module flows with deliberate purpose into others, creating an omnichannel, omnipresent customer insight reservoir. A lead’s metamorphosis from Marketing Cloud to Sales Cloud exemplifies a frictionless trajectory, while Service Cloud analytics can recalibrate marketing strategies with granular precision. The business analyst’s role is to trace these conduits, detect bottlenecks, and optimize cross-functional synergies to fortify enterprise efficiency.

Salesforce’s prominence in enterprise ecosystems hinges upon its rigorous data governance framework. Organizations steward sensitive information spanning financial records, personal identifiers, and behavioral data, necessitating an intricate lattice of access controls and security policies. Role hierarchies, permission sets, and sharing rules establish both vertical and lateral visibility, ensuring that users encounter data consonant with their operational mandate. Analysts interpret these structures, balancing accessibility against regulatory and ethical imperatives, thus safeguarding organizational integrity.
Security extends beyond mere access; it encompasses encryption protocols, audit trails, and compliance alignment with regulatory regimes. The business analyst’s cognizance of these protocols ensures that process design neither circumvents nor compromises security, integrating compliance as a non-negotiable aspect of functional architecture.
